Как преобразовать формат данных при создании DataFrame из файла?

Здравствуйте. При создании DataFrame из файла и последующим использовании информации из ячеек, формат даты меняется: изначально dd.mm.yyyy, после – dd-mm-yyyy 00:00:00. Как быстро и просто оставить исходный формат?
import pandas as pd

data = pd.read_excel("data_base.xlsx", keep_default_na=False)
print(data.head().loc[2,'Дата'])         #2019-11-05 00:00:00
  • Вопрос задан
  • 92 просмотра
Пригласить эксперта
Ответы на вопрос 2
adugin
@adugin Куратор тега Python
Можно попробовать так:
data = pd.read_excel("data_base.xlsx", keep_default_na=False, parse_dates=False)

А вообще непонятно, чем вам мешает такой формат.
Ответ написан
Комментировать
@dmshar
Так
d='2020-11-13 10:55:09' 
date=pd.to_datetime(d).date()
print(date)

Результат:
2020-11-13
Или так:
d='2020-11-13 10:55:09' 
date=pd.to_datetime(d).strftime('%d.%m.%Y')
print(date)

Результат
13.11.2020
Ответ написан
Ваш ответ на вопрос

Войдите, чтобы написать ответ

Войти через центр авторизации
Похожие вопросы
19 апр. 2024, в 17:06
15000 руб./за проект
19 апр. 2024, в 16:53
1000 руб./за проект
19 апр. 2024, в 16:45
5000 руб./за проект